NVIDIA GTX 970 graphics
From the biggest MMOs to the latest triple-A titles, you can experience games with incredible detail and high frame rates thanks to the NVIDIA GTX 970 graphics card.
It's powerful enough to let you turn the graphics settings right up on even the most demanding games at 1080p - perfect for gaming on a single monitor or TV.
Intel Skylake performance
Performance comes courtesy of a 6th generation Intel Core i7 processor. This quad-core processor runs at an impressive 4.0 GHz to quickly handle anything you can throw at it. Even when the time comes to upgrade your graphics card, you don't need to worry about bottlenecking or the processor holding your gaming experience back.
It's also more than capable of running industry standard media production and editing software, making the ENVY Phoenix ideal for everyday performance computing along with enthusiast level gaming.
Dual storage
The ENVY Phoenix combines a high-capacity 2 TB hard drive with a fast 128 GB solid-state drive (SSD). Windows 10 is preloaded onto the SSD for rapid booting, so you aren't left waiting around for your PC to start up. There's still plenty of space left on the SSD to install your favourite game for faster loading and smoother all-around action.
Made for gamers
From the living room to the a dedicated gaming area, the ENVY Phoenix fits into any environment thanks to the smart Gun Metal chassis. The LED lighting changes depending on how hard the system is working, while tool-less access makes customising the PC and adding components simple.
